Soft, low‑frequency vibrations creep upward like a gentle whoosh, capturing the precise motion of a camera zooming toward focus. The texture is a subdued, almost whispered whine threaded with a thin hiss, while delicate harmonics unfurl just beneath the surface, imitating the slight mechanical resonance of a rotating lens barrel. Its intensity stays modest—steady enough to remain under the main action yet present enough to suggest intentional shifting.

In practice this piece functions as an ambient bridge between scenes or settings. Its unobtrusive rise signals a change without jolting the viewer, making it ideal for quiet UI transitions or the gentle background of documentary cuts where a subtle visual pivot needs an accompanying sonic cue. When placed behind dialogue or footage, the hiss and rising pitch reinforce a sense of depth, drawing attention to the impending close‑up without overtly breaking the flow.

From a production standpoint, the clip is crafted through layered microphone capture and careful equalisation. Engineers often layer a deep sub‑bass drone with filtered tape hiss, then apply a slow, linear ramp to the high‑mid range for the harmonic swell. Slight stereo widening gives the impression of a lens turning inside a space, while a touch of reverberation places the sound within a realistic interior context. The result is a smooth sweep that feels organically integrated rather than added on.
